How long do First Look photos take? A first look normally takes anywhere from 15 to 30 minutes. That time fits in the wedding timeline one to two hours before guests start arriving. You want to make sure that your wedding ceremony happens at the right time so you have enough time for everything.
Photographers Arrival to the ceremony: At least 30 minutes before the ceremony start time. Allow time for your photographer to set up at the church and capture the ceremony location, guests arriving and other details.
Its totally okay if couples choose not to do a First Look on their wedding day. Its just our preference to do one for many reasons, which we will share. Ninety percent of Brides do a first look. They are amazing!
A First Look is a moment that a couple shares before their actual wedding ceremony, where they see each other for the first time in their formal attire, all dressed up. Usually, the couple is alone during this time with their photographer present to capture those first intimate moments.
ADVICE The first look should be around 20-30 minutes. During this time, the bride and groom enjoy seeing each other for the first time on the wedding day. While the actual first look might only be 15 minutes, the rest of the time is spent on a few basic portraits of the bride and groom.
1 to 1.5 hours is the ideal amount of time for wedding party photos. If theres a bit of travel between the ceremony and reception locations, allow for this.
So what is the 30/5 rule? Its the rule that accounts for things that typically take 5 minutes in real life that will take 30 minutes on a wedding day. It also means that 30 minutes on a wedding day will feel like 5 minutes. You may have heard people say over and over that your wedding day will fly by.
Professional photographers take pictures in whats called RAW file format. These end up being really large files that are most suitable for photo editing (because they retain a lot more image detail), but not good for much else.
